ILROB 4295
Organizations Across the Lifecycle
Cornell University ·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
This course reviews sociological theory and research on a selected set of common issues and problems that face organizations as they go from founding to established operations. We begin by examining factors that affect people's decisions to found new organizations, then consider choices in organization and job design, problems of exercising authority and influence effectively, group dynamics that may affect decision-making and coordination, and different approaches to managing cooperative and competitive relations with external audiences. Course topics will be examined through readings, class discussion, cases and interactive exercises.
